(Webinar) An Inside View of the EEOC, NYS Division of Human Rights, and NYC Commission on Human Rights

Monday, May 15, 2023 | 5:00 pm – 6:30 pm

Program Chair:

Rebecca Berkebile
Mount Sinai Health System, Associate General Counsel

  • Join the Acting District Director of the New York District Office of the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ission, the General Counsel of the New York State Division of Human Rights, and the Deputy Commissioner of the New York City Commission on Human Rights as they take a deep dive into how their agencies investigate employment discrimination complaints. When do the agencies ask to speak with the parties or witnesses? How much back and forth is normal, and when is it indicative of a likely determination of probable cause? How often are determinations reconsidered and reversed? Hear from those in the know about these topics and more – including enforcement of the new salary transparency law – at this not-to-be-missed CLE.
